It is beyond the scope of this short article to cover every possible mix of household situations, however here is a general format for a traditionally worded invite, with some common alternatives italicized and described in adjacent notes: Note that complete given names and middle names are used (no nicknames!), and nothing is abbreviated except titles like Mr - wedding invitation sample., Mrs., Dr.

The bride-to-be's name is listed before the groom's, the groom has a title (Mr.) however the bride does not. The British spelling of the word "honour" is utilized for a church event - wedding invitation mockup. State names, years, dates and times are all drawn up fully, and note that "half after 4 o'clock" is used rather than "four-thirty." Commas are utilized just to separate the day and date, and the city and state.

The RSVP due date on your action card ought to be one month before your wedding event date, so that you have sufficient time to determine seating plans, then have escort cards and place cards printed. Here is an example of a standard action card: The favour of a reply is requested before the twenty-sixth of AugustM will attendM will be unable to participate in Keep in mind the English spelling of the word "favour." Reaction cards must never request for the variety of guests concerning the weddinginstead, the specific names of visitors who are being welcomed are indicated on your envelope( s), and those guests who can pertain to the wedding event will so indicate by composing their names in the appropriate blank on the card.

Lots of couples drop the conventional "M" in front of the blank line, so visitors can write their names more casually. wedding invitation inner envelope. A pre-addressed, stamped envelope accompanies the more traditional form of action card, but some contemporary variations are designed as a postcard, with the address and stamp put on the rear end of the card.

Since a directions card is a reasonably current development, there are no strict guidelines regarding its format. You can provide the info either in the form of explicit written instructions, or alternatively you can provide an illustrated map.

Depending upon your particular circumstances, you might be required to provide any or all of the following type of info: Valet parkingIf this is being offered, it should be suggested immediately following the driving instructions. Group transportation plans you have made for your guestsIndicate where and when your visitors require to meet to take the transportation, and in setting a departure time, allow an additional 15 minutes to guarantee an on-time arrival.

Kid care plans that you have madeA excellent method to motivate visitors with kids to go to, while keeping the kids from crashing your celebration, if that's your preference. Proper outfit for the weddingFor example, "black tie" for a formal wedding event, or "garden shoes suggested" for an outdoor wedding where you don't desire the women aerating the lawn with spiked heels.

Other things to doIf it's a location wedding, you might desire to provide info on location destinations. The hosts of the wedding need to be listed here. This can be the bride's parents, the groom's parents, both, or neither. For more informal phrasing, the moms and dad's very first and last names can be listed rather of utilizing titles. For example: Cheryl and William Lewis (the lady's name is listed first, as the man's very first name ought to not be separated from his last name).
